9 AM--The Bridesmaids

"You did what? I don't believe this." Lateisha was trying hard not to yell at Jenny. "Some husky comes up to you the morning of the wedding day and wants to change the ceremony and you agreed? Do you know how hard John's been working on this?" She sighed. *No point taking this out on Jenny* "OK, point out the husky and let me give her a piece of my mind."

Katie saw one of the does approaching her breathing fire and wondered what was wrong. She didn't have to wonder long.

"You had a whole week to do this. John is terrified at the thought of anything going wrong. He's been knocking himself out the whole week trying to make everything perfect. Then you come along the morning--the morning--of the wedding day and get Jenny and Spike worked up about an addition to the ceremony. You couldn't talk to John? You couldn't talk to me? What the hell do you think you were doing?"

Katie was wilting before the blast of Lateisha's wrath. "Rings, you know, for a wedding. I thought they would be nice."

"THIS IS NOT ABOUT RINGS! This is about you not having any respect for what goes on here!"

Katie was getting a better idea of how Harry and Zack had felt after their last meeting with Naomi. "I'm sorry, OK? I didn't think."

"Yeah, you didn't think." Lateisha felt the edge of her anger go off. "Let me talk to John, maybe there's a way to work it in. You get any more bright ideas--any of you huskies get any more bright ideas--you clear it with him or me first, is that clear?"

Katie felt her head lower and her tail go between her legs. "Yes, ma'am." Lateisha stalked off.

9 AM--Juanita

Juanita couldn't take it anymore. Yes, she remembered she had taken the vow with the rest of the founders of the park not to assume her true form until anthros had achieved societal acceptance. But none of the other founders were working around people who wore their own true form every day! And the huskies were mostly people who preferred the human form and planned to go back to it, which made the whole thing even more irritating. And now every anthro in the Park, it seemed, would be attending the wedding, relaxing in their wonderful anthro bodies. And as a human she couldn't even go.

*OK, just one day. And as a husky I can blend in. No one has to know, I can erase the transformation logs. Naomi can just introduce me as a new husky.*

Juanita picked up the dedicated communicator that connected her to Naomi.

9:05 AM--Naomi

*What is that doe yelling at Katie about?* Naomi wondered. She was about to intervene when she felt the vibration of her collar telling her that she was about to receive a communication from Juanita.

"Naomi, I want you to come back here as soon as you can. There's something that I need your help with. It should take around twenty minutes. Don't tell anyone I called you."

"OK, it should take me a few minutes to get things set up here."

Naomi walked over to Katie, who seemed a bit down after being yelled at. "What was that about?" she asked.

"I, uh, tried to give them something for the ceremony, and she got mad at me for interfering." *I'm in trouble now* Katie thought.

Naomi was torn. Obviously, Katie had screwed up, and Naomi would need to get to the bottom of this sooner or later. On the other hand, pack leader Juanita's wishes had to take precedence. "Is the situation resolved? Yes or no."

"Yes."

"OK, I have to go for about a half an hour. You're in charge till I get back. Don't screw up any more."

"Yes, ma'am." Katie barked. Naomi loped off.

9:15 AM--Juanita and Naomi

Naomi wasn't bothered by the fact that pack leader Juanita wanted to assume anthro-canine form. If anything, that seemed to make things a little more logical, that the pack leader would be of the same species as the pack. But she was having a hard time getting her head around the idea that the pack leader in her new form wanted to be treated as another member of the pack, in fact as one of Naomi's underlings. She wasn't sure she would be able to carry this off.

Still, if that's what pack leader Juanita wanted. Naomi watched the transformation chamber work its magic, as Juanita's skin erupted into fur, as her face narrowed and her nose pushed forward, as her fingernails were replaced by claws. The newest husky stepped from the transformation chamber, her face transfigured in one of the purest expressions of joy Naomi had ever seen.
